The list of architectural monuments in Fischlaken contains the listed buildings in the area of Essen-Fischlaken , district IX, in North Rhine-Westphalia (as of October 2018). These architectural monuments are entered in the monuments list of the city of Essen; The basis for the admission is the Monument Protection Act North Rhine-Westphalia (DSchG NRW).  Map with all coordinates: OSM | WikiMapf1Georeferencing

BW Organ of the Catholic Church To the Sorrowful Mother Mary Ludscheidtstrasse 4
map
Organ by the master organ builder Friedrich Bernhard Meyer from Herford . It was built in 1890 for the Protestant church of the Dortmund-Brackel parish, which it sold in 1958 to the Catholic parish of St. Ludgerus Werden , which had it set up in its branch church, To the Sorrowful Mother. 1890 13 Mar 2014 966
